So if you’ve been living under a rock, you may not know that Kanye has not only joined Twitter, but has since taken a huge liking to the apocalypse kid Justin Bieber on Twitter, to the point that they went back and forth over a possible collab including Raekwon. While I saw this as total nonsense, it turns out that it’s in fact true, as The Chef explains to XXL during a phone interview:
“It’s definitely gonna happen. When you got these kinda talents merging together to do something exciting, I think it’s something that’s gonna make the fans check it out. I’m big fans of both of these guys. I think, at the end of the day, shorty is a sensation. And [for him] to acknowledge me it makes me feel good that the young generation is checkin’ me out like that. And at the same time it gives me a position to play a big brother in the game. He wants my assistance or whatever he can get it. I respect him, I like his style.”
“Yeezy called me and we gon’ make it pop. At the end of the day we’re all doing our thing in the game and for them to even just have a conversation and just put my name in it it feels good. It feels good to respect what I do and I respect what they do. And we gon’ make a hit. Justin got his own fan base and Me and Yeezy got our own fan base and we gon’ make it happen. We gon’ make a good record.”
